Can Antihistamines Help With Trouble in Falling Asleep?


------------------------------------------------------------------------------

QUESTION:  I have trouble falling asleep, probably because I am always so
anxious.  Do you think that antihistamines can help a problem like mine.  My
brother uses them for his allergy and says they make him sleepy.

------------------------------------------------------------------------------

ANSWER:  Antihistamines are better known as a treatment for runny noses and
itches due to allergies, but because they cause drowsiness, they're also the
main ingredient in several sleeping aids.  This is a case where the side
effect of a medication used for one condition is used to treat a completely
different condition.
     Insomnia associated with anxiety can be a problem.  Because
antihistamines are not habit forming and are extremely safe, they can help you
fall asleep more easily.  In turn, sleep, and the rest it provides,  may ease
some of your anxiety problems.
     There are several sleeping aid products with antihistamines you can buy
in a drug store, including Compoz, Nytol, Unisom, and Sominex.  Use these
medications occasionally and only as directed, and tell your physician you are
taking them.  Your physician may recommend one of these or prescribe a
stronger antihistamine, or if they should fail to bring you the relief you
seek, prescribe an antianxiety drug instead.
